diff options
author | Sandy Carter | 2016-10-28 18:59:39 -0400 |
---|---|---|
committer | Sandy Carter | 2016-10-28 18:59:39 -0400 |
commit | 58eaf23aa50013d8351563cae6b5c0b9956cd36a (patch) | |
tree | 7ea5ad9dc801d16c7160c4347c368a163efdde1f | |
parent | 7edd816f3624f13a52b39cde0de4f4a5f922f701 (diff) | |
download | aur-58eaf23aa50013d8351563cae6b5c0b9956cd36a.tar.gz |
Update virtualenv to 15.03, pypy3 to 3.3
Known bug that urllib.request does not contain HTTPSHandler.
-rw-r--r-- | .SRCINFO | 8 | ||||
-rw-r--r-- | PKGBUILD | 26 |
2 files changed, 20 insertions, 14 deletions
@@ -1,15 +1,15 @@ pkgbase = pypy-virtualenv pkgdesc = Virtual Python Environment builder for pypy - pkgver = 13.1.2 + pkgver = 15.0.3 pkgrel = 1 url = https://virtualenv.pypa.io/ arch = any license = MIT makedepends = pypy makedepends = pypy3 - source = http://pypi.python.org/packages/source/v/virtualenv/virtualenv-13.1.2.tar.gz - md5sums = b989598f068d64b32dead530eb25589a - sha256sums = aabc8ef18cddbd8a2a9c7f92bc43e2fea54b1147330d65db920ef3ce9812e3dc + source = https://pypi.io/packages/source/v/virtualenv/virtualenv-15.0.3.tar.gz + md5sums = a5a061ad8a37d973d27eb197d05d99bf + sha256sums = 6d9c760d3fc5fa0894b0f99b9de82a4647e1164f0b700a7f99055034bf548b1d pkgname = pypy-virtualenv depends = pypy @@ -3,30 +3,33 @@ # Contributor: Daniele Paolella <dp@mcrservice.it> pkgname=('pypy-virtualenv' 'pypy3-virtualenv') -pkgver=13.1.2 +pkgver=15.0.3 pkgrel=1 pkgdesc="Virtual Python Environment builder for pypy" url="https://virtualenv.pypa.io/" arch=('any') license=('MIT') makedepends=('pypy' 'pypy3') -source=("http://pypi.python.org/packages/source/v/virtualenv/virtualenv-$pkgver.tar.gz") -md5sums=('b989598f068d64b32dead530eb25589a') -sha256sums=('aabc8ef18cddbd8a2a9c7f92bc43e2fea54b1147330d65db920ef3ce9812e3dc') +source=("https://pypi.io/packages/source/v/virtualenv/virtualenv-$pkgver.tar.gz") +md5sums=('a5a061ad8a37d973d27eb197d05d99bf') +sha256sums=('6d9c760d3fc5fa0894b0f99b9de82a4647e1164f0b700a7f99055034bf548b1d') package_pypy-virtualenv() { depends=('pypy') cd "$srcdir/virtualenv-$pkgver" - /usr/bin/pypy setup.py build - /usr/bin/pypy setup.py install --root="$pkgdir" + # should report this upstream as still not fixed... + sed -i "s|#!/usr/bin/env python$|#!/usr/bin/env pypy|" virtualenv.py + + LANG='en_US.UTF-8' pypy setup.py build + LANG='en_US.UTF-8' pypy setup.py install --root="$pkgdir" mkdir -p "${pkgdir}"/usr/bin # link to a version with 2 suffix as well ln "$pkgdir/opt/pypy/bin/virtualenv" "$pkgdir/usr/bin/virtualenv-pypy2" - ln "$pkgdir/opt/pypy/bin/virtualenv-2.7" "$pkgdir/usr/bin/virtualenv-pypy-2.7" + ln "$pkgdir/opt/pypy/bin/virtualenv" "$pkgdir/usr/bin/virtualenv-pypy-2.7" ln "$pkgdir/usr/bin/virtualenv-pypy2" "$pkgdir/usr/bin/virtualenv-pypy" install -D -m644 LICENSE.txt "$pkgdir/usr/share/licenses/$pkgname/LICENSE" @@ -37,14 +40,17 @@ package_pypy3-virtualenv() { cd "$srcdir/virtualenv-$pkgver" - /usr/bin/pypy3 setup.py build - /usr/bin/pypy3 setup.py install --root="$pkgdir" + # should report this upstream as still not fixed... + sed -i "s|#!/usr/bin/env python$|#!/usr/bin/env pypy3|" virtualenv.py + + LANG='en_US.UTF-8' pypy3 setup.py build + LANG='en_US.UTF-8' pypy3 setup.py install --root="$pkgdir" mkdir -p "${pkgdir}"/usr/bin # link to a version with 2 suffix as well ln "$pkgdir/opt/pypy3/bin/virtualenv" "$pkgdir/usr/bin/virtualenv-pypy3" - ln "$pkgdir/opt/pypy3/bin/virtualenv-3.2" "$pkgdir/usr/bin/virtualenv-pypy-3.2" + ln "$pkgdir/opt/pypy3/bin/virtualenv" "$pkgdir/usr/bin/virtualenv-pypy-3.3" install -D -m644 LICENSE.txt "$pkgdir/usr/share/licenses/$pkgname/LICENSE" } |